We are currently seeking an experienced Principal HSSE Training & Communications for one of our key client in the Energy sector. This strategic role is instrumental in driving health, safety, security, and environmental (HSSE) performance through targeted training, capability development, and internal communications initiatives.

The successful candidate will provide leadership and subject matter expertise in identifying and addressing training and competency needs across the organisation. This includes designing and implementing end-to-end HSSE training programs and communication strategies that promote a culture of safety and continuous improvement, all in alignment with the company's values and management systems.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Serve as the subject matter expert for HSSE training and communications, offering strategic direction and operational support.
  • Identify organisational training and capability gaps in collaboration with HSSE and technical experts.
  • Design and implement enterprise-wide HSSE training and communication strategies, including regulatory compliance programs, high-risk competencies, and leadership development initiatives.
  • Oversee the development and delivery of key training programs such as company inductions, Frontline Safety Leadership, STRIVE, and specialist/high-risk HSSE training.
  • Maintain and enhance the HSSE technical competency framework, integrating it into broader organisational training structures.
  • Ensure optimal use of the company's learning management system (LMS) to manage, monitor and forecast training needs and compliance.
  • Produce engaging and effective training materials—presentations, manuals, and digital content—to support learning and capability uplift.
  • Lead the planning and execution of key HSSE communication campaigns, awareness initiatives, and cultural improvement programs.
  • Establish governance and performance measurement systems to track the effectiveness and legal compliance of all training and communication activities.
  • Engage with industry bodies, regulators, and external networks (e.g., Safer Together, IOGP, AEP) to ensure alignment with best practice and legislative changes.

Ideal Candidate Profile:

  • Minimum 5 years' experience in a HSSE training and capability development role, ideally within the resources or energy sector.
  • Demonstrated expertise in designing, delivering, and managing large-scale training programs, with a focus on compliance and risk mitigation.
  • Strong facilitation and communication skills, with the ability to influence and engage stakeholders at all levels.
  • Solid understanding of HSSE systems and standards, including ISO 45001 and ISO 14001.
  • Experienced in using LMS and digital learning tools to deliver and track competency programs.

Key Qualifications:

  • Tertiary qualifications in training & development, occupational health & safety, communications, or related discipline.
  • Certificate IV in Training and Assessment – essential.
